Up to 7km deep. 1200km long. Almost 500 fossil whales, some over 5 million years old. An epic new finding that shows how much unknown natural treasures the sea floor holds 🧪🐋

A new ~2 Ma hominin cranium just discovered at the Drimolen hominin site in South Africa as part of a newly funded @arc-gov-au.bsky.social project to @ltuarchaeology.bsky.social @latrobe.edu.au and University of Johannesburg. The first year of joint Drimolen-Kromdraai excavations.

The out-of-Africa migration, in which ancient humans went on to inhabit every other continent except Antarctica, may not have been one moment in time, but a long and slow process. Columnist Michael Ma...
